Remarks: For a very brief while in early 2003, WC power became an almost daily occurence on NS manifest train #175. Apparently CN must've owed NS a lot of horsepower hours and was paying them off with their "junk" power (much to our delight!). At 12:40pm on Friday, January 24, 2003, southbound manifest train #175 has WC SD45s #7498 and #6583, CN SD40-2 #6125, with GTW GP38-2 #5832 in charge as it glides through the milepost 79.7H grade crossing in Rome, Georgia, on NS's Atlanta North District. This is one of the most "exotic" locomotive consists that I've ever been fortunate enough to capture on video in Georgia.
